A tablet data provider offers different plans for data usage. The plan Raul chose has a monthly fee of $29.99 per month for 5 GB

if data with an additional cost of $10 for each gigabyte over 5.
a. Write an expression for Raul’s monthly data costs.
b. Raul learns that his data provider is iffy unlimited data plan for $59.99 per month. Find the minimum number if gigabytes Raul could use per month to make the unlimited plan cheaper than his current plan. Explain your solution process.

(a) The expression for Raul's monthly data costs is 29.99 + 10 (n - 5).

(b) The minimum number is 9 GB to make the unlimited plan cheaper.

  • The plan Raul chose has a monthly fee of $29.99 per month for 5 GB of data, with an additional cost of $10 for each gigabyte over 5.
  • Assume that he will use "n" gigabyte per month.
  • The monthly fee is $29.99 for 5 GB.
  • The cost per GB after the first 5 GB is $10.
  • The number of GB whose cost is $10 is (n - 5).
  • His monthly fees = 29.99 + 10 (n - 5) ⇒ current plan
  • The fees for the unlimited plan is $59.99 per month.
  • We need an unlimited cheaper plan than the current one.
  • Let the current plan be expensive than the unlimited plan.
  • 29.99 + 10 (n - 5) > 59.99
  • Subtract 29.99 from both sides.
  • 10 (n - 5) > 30
  • Divide both sides by 10.
  • n - 5 > 3
  • Add 5 to both sides.
  • n > 8
  • The minimum number is 9 GB to make the unlimited cheaper.
